LAHORE: The Christian community held a protest demonstration on Sunday against the ransacking and burning of their homes in Joseph Colony in the Badami Bagh area.
Protestors chanted slogans against the provincial government, administration and police. Traffic was also blocked on Ferozepur road. Protestors pelted the Metro buses and police with stones. Police resorted to aerial firing and baton charging to disperse the protestors.
Protests were also held in several cities across Pakistan including Karachi, Lahore and Rawalpindi.
On March 9, over 100 homes of the Christian community were ransacked and set on fire by an angry over alleged blasphemy committed by Sawan Masih.
Meanwhile over 100 people allegedly involved in the incident had been arrested from different areas of Lahore. According to DIG Operations Rai Tahir, more raids will be conducted to arrest others involved.
